Skip to contents

Map an LLM provider name to its environment variable

Usage

llm_env_var(provider)

Arguments

provider

character(1) one of "openai", "anthropic", "claude", "gemini", "google", "ollama"

Value

character(1) environment variable name, or "" for keyless providers

Examples

llm_env_var("anthropic")
#> [1] "ANTHROPIC_API_KEY"
llm_env_var("ollama")   # "" — ollama needs no key
#> [1] ""